Sqrt

/skwɛr rut/ noun

Definition

Mathematical abbreviation for square root, a value that when multiplied by itself gives the original number.

Etymology

Abbreviation of 'square root', where 'square' comes from Old French 'esquarre' meaning 'four-sided figure', and 'root' from Old Norse 'rót' meaning 'source' or 'origin'. The mathematical concept dates to ancient civilizations, but the abbreviated form emerged with computer programming.
